На главную

On-line справка по Win32 API

Написать письмо
БЕСПЛАТНАЯ ежедневная online лотерея! Выигрывай каждый день БЕСПЛАТНО!
Список всех статей A-B-C-D-E-F-G-H-I-J-K-L-M-N-O-P-Q-R-S-T-U-V-W-X-Y-Z | Скачать Вниз

SetConsoleCursorInfo



The SetConsoleCursorInfo function sets the size and visibility of the cursor for the specified console screen buffer.

BOOL SetConsoleCursorInfo(

HANDLE hConsoleOutput, // handle of console screen buffer
CONST CONSOLE_CURSOR_INFO *lpConsoleCursorInfo // address of cursor information
);


Parameters

hConsoleOutput

Identifies a console screen buffer. The handle must have GENERIC_WRITE access.

lpConsoleCursorInfo

Points to a CONSOLE_CURSOR_INFO structure containing the new specifications for the screen buffer's cursor.



Return Values

If the function succeeds, the return value is nonzero.
If the function fails, the return value is zero. To get extended error information, call GetLastError.

Remarks

When a screen buffer's cursor is visible, its appearance can vary, ranging from completely filling a character cell to showing up as a horizontal line at the bottom of the cell. The dwSize member of the CONSOLE_CURSOR_INFO structure specifies the percentage of a character cell that is filled by the cursor. If this member is less than 1 or greater than 100, SetConsoleCursorInfo fails.

See Also

CONSOLE_CURSOR_INFO, GetConsoleCursorInfo, SetConsoleCursorPosition


Пригласи друзей и счет твоего мобильника всегда будет положительным!
Предыдущая статья
 
Сайт Народ.Ру Интернет
Следующая статья
Пригласи друзей и счет твоего мобильника всегда будет положительным!

SetConsoleCursorInfo



Функция SetConsoleCursorInfo устанавливает размер и видимость курсора для определенного консольного экранного буфера.

BOOL SetConsoleCursorInfo(

РУЧКА hConsoleOutput, // ручка консольного экрана буферизуют CONST CONSOLE_CURSOR_INFO *адрес lpConsoleCursorInfo // информации курсора
);


Параметры

hConsoleOutput

Идентифицирует консольный экранный буфер. Ручка должна иметь доступ GENERIC_WRITE.

lpConsoleCursorInfo

Точки на структуру CONSOLE_CURSOR_INFO, содержащие новую спецификацию для экранного буферного курсора.



Обратные Величины

Если функция добивается успеха, обратная величина ненулевая.
Если функция терпит неудачу, обратная величина нулевая. Для того, чтобы расширять информацию ошибки, назовите GetLastError.

Замечания

Когда экранный буферный курсор видимый, появление может поменять, диапазон чтобы полностью заполнять символьную ячейку в появляться как горизонтальная строка внизу ячейки. Элемент dwSize структуры CONSOLE_CURSOR_INFO определяет процент символьной ячейки, которая заполнена курсором. Если этот элемент - менее чем 1 или больше, чем 100, SetConsoleCursorInfo терпит неудачу.

Смотри Также

CONSOLE_CURSOR_INFO, GetConsoleCursorInfo, SetConsoleCursorPosition


Вверх Version 1.3, Oct 26 2010 © 2007, 2010, mrhx Вверх
 mrhx software  Русский перевод OpenGL  Русский перевод Win32 API
 
Используются технологии uCoz